Transaction 381fddbb891b1525e2e86dbb62e4b2f7ae262354afc505271985e34a03a95c1b
1 Input
1 Output
-
381fddbb891b1525e2e86dbb62e4b2f7ae262354afc505271985e34a03a95c1b:0
- value
- 1642273
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 872852175eeddc4401c68f8ad31cbb53a02f2bfd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DKeXRj7JacLfaaZ9x57FwzJ1iZNWZ3F6K